Travel trends in the U.S. today reflect a clear shift: tourists increasingly seek autonomy and efficiency, especially in fast-paced cities like Tampa. While ride-sharing and public transport serve well in some contexts, they often struggle during peak hours or when visiting less central neighborhoods. A car rental eliminates dependency on fluctuating bus picks or delayed rideshare apps, offering a reliable alternative that keeps journeys on track — even late in the day or when spontaneous detours are planned. This independence lets travelers fully embrace Tampa’s diverse landscapes, from downtown skyline tours to hidden gems in Ybor City and beyond.

When planning a trip through Tampa, many visitors face a familiar challenge: sitting in gridlock while trying to reach the city’s top attractions, beaches, or dining hotspots. With growing congestion in urban centers and packed public transit schedules, the idea of relying on buses or rideshares often feels slower and less flexible. That’s why every Tampa visitor benefits from a car rental — a smart choice that unlocks smoother travel, expanded access, and a richer exploration experience.

    The real value of a rental car lies in its ability to simplify navigation and expand mobility. Traffic in Tampa’s core areas can bring entire blocks to a standstill, making walking slow and inefficient for multi-stop itineraries. With a car, visitors navigate directly to destinations without waiting, avoid backtracking, and discover overlooked spots—like scenic coastal routes or local markets—without disrupting their schedule. Performance on dry days or light rain is consistent, and the vehicle’s flexibility supports day trips to nearby attractions such as Tampa Bay beaches, adventure parks, or wine country—ensuring plans stay on track.

    Daily rates start around $40–$70 depending on vehicle type and season, with discounts available for longer rentals; add insurance and fuel policies to budget accordingly.
